当前位置:首页 > 行业动态 > 正文

华为云数据库怎么用

华为云数据库使用步骤:1. 登录华为云官网;2. 选择数据库服务;3. 创建数据库实例;4. 配置参数;5. 连接数据库。

华为云数据库接入(华为云数据库使用)

准备工作

1、注册华为云账号:访问华为云官网,点击注册按钮,填写相关信息完成注册。

2、创建云数据库实例:登录华为云控制台,选择“数据库”服务,点击“创建数据库”,根据需求选择数据库类型和配置参数。

3、获取连接信息:在数据库实例详情页面,可以查看到连接地址、端口、用户名和密码等信息,用于后续的数据库连接。

安装驱动

根据所选数据库类型,下载相应的数据库驱动,并进行安装,如果选择了MySQL数据库,可以前往MySQL官方网站下载对应的JDBC驱动。

连接数据库

1、导入相关依赖:根据所使用的编程语言,将下载的数据库驱动导入到项目中。

2、建立数据库连接:使用数据库连接工具或代码,根据连接信息建立与数据库的连接,以下是一个Java代码示例: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class DatabaseConnection {
    public static void main(String[] args) {
        String url = "jdbc:mysql://<连接地址>:<端口>/<数据库名>?useUnicode=true&characterEncoding=utf8&serverTimezone=Asia/Shanghai";
        String username = "<用户名>";
        String password = "<密码>";
        Connection connection = null;
        try {
            Class.forName("com.mysql.cj.jdbc.Driver"); // 加载驱动类
            connection = DriverManager.getConnection(url, username, password); // 建立连接
            System.out.println("数据库连接成功!");
        } catch (ClassNotFoundException e) {
            e.printStackTrace();
        } catch (SQLException e) {
            e.printStackTrace();
        } finally {
            if (connection != null) {
                try {
                    connection.close(); // 关闭连接
                } catch (SQLException e) {
                    e.printStackTrace();
                }
            }
        }
    }
}

执行SQL操作

通过已建立的数据库连接,可以使用Java提供的JDBC API执行SQL语句进行数据的增删改查等操作,以下是一个简单的查询示例:

import java.sql.Connection;
import java.sql.ResultSet;
import java.sql.Statement;
import java.sql.SQLException;
public class SQLOperations {
    public static void main(String[] args) {
        // 省略数据库连接部分...
        Statement statement = null;
        ResultSet resultSet = null;
        try {
            statement = connection.createStatement(); // 创建Statement对象
            String query = "SELECT * FROM <表名>"; // 编写SQL查询语句
            resultSet = statement.executeQuery(query); // 执行查询并获取结果集
            while (resultSet.next()) { // 遍历结果集并输出数据
                System.out.println(resultSet.getString("<列名>"));
            }
        } catch (SQLException e) {
            e.printStackTrace();
        } finally {
            // 关闭资源...
        }
    }
}

问题与解答栏目:与本文相关的问题与解答如下

1、问题:如何选择合适的数据库类型?

解答:选择合适的数据库类型需要考虑应用的需求和特点,常见的数据库类型包括关系型数据库(如MySQL、Oracle)、NoSQL数据库(如MongoDB、Redis)和分布式数据库(如HBase、Cassandra),根据应用的数据结构、读写性能要求以及扩展性等因素进行选择。

0

随机文章